What are Remote Workfront System Administrators?

Remote Workfront System Administrators are professionals who manage and maintain the Adobe Workfront platform for organizations from a remote location. They are responsible for configuring the system, managing user permissions,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ring the platform aligns with business processes. Their role often includes training users, creating custom reports, and integrating Workfront with other business tools. By working remotely, they offer flexibility while supporting global teams and ensuring project management workflows run smoothly.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Workfront System Administr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Workfront System Administrator, you need expertise in system administration, project management processes, and experience with Adobe Workfront, often supported by a relevant bachelor’s degree or certifications. Familiarity with Workfront configuration, API integrations, and reporting tools like Fusion or Tableau is typically required. Strong problem-solving, communication, and organizational skills are essential to effectively collaborate with distributed teams and manage system improvements. These abilities ensure seamless workflow automation, user adoption, and efficient project delivery in a remote environment.

What is the difference between Remote Workfront System Administrator vs Remote Workfront Developer?

AspectRemote Workfront System AdministratorRemote Workfront Developer
CredentialsWorkfront certifications, IT or system admin backgroundWorkfront certifications, programming or development skills
Work EnvironmentSystem management, user support, configurationCustom development, API integration, scripting
Industry UsageProject management, IT services, enterprise solutionsSoftware development, customization, automation

The Remote Workfront System Administrator primarily manages and supports the Workfront platform, focusing on configuration, user management, and system health. In contrast, the Remote Workfront Developer specializes in customizing the platform through coding, API integrations, and automation. Both roles require Workfront certifications and are vital in organizations leveraging Workfront for project management, but they differ in technical focus and daily tasks.

What are some common challenges faced by a Remote Workfront System Administrator and how can they be addressed?

A Remote Workfront System Administrator often encounters challenges related to communicating updates and changes to geographically dispersed teams, managing user permissions across multiple departments, and troubleshooting issues without direct, in-person access to users. To overcome these hurdles, administrators should implement clear documentation practices, establish regular training sessions, and leverage collaboration tools to streamline support and feedback. Proactively maintaining system configurations and staying current with platform updates also helps prevent and quickly resolve potential technical issues.
